Tips for hiring e-commerce freelancers

When hiring e-commerce freelancers, prioritize those with proven track records in your specific platform. A Shopify expert with 50+ store launches will solve problems in hours that a generalist developer would struggle with for days. Ask candidates for case studies showing measurable results — revenue increases, conversion rate improvements, or traffic growth.

Ensure your freelancers understand the Canadian e-commerce landscape, including bilingual requirements for Quebec, Canadian Anti-Spam Legislation (CASL) for email marketing, GST/HST/PST calculations, and integration with Canada Post or local fulfillment providers.

Start with a small, well-defined project before committing to a larger engagement. A product page redesign or a specific marketing campaign gives you a clear picture of the freelancer's skills, communication style, and reliability before you trust them with your entire store.

How much does it cost to build a custom Shopify store with a freelancer in Canada?

A custom Shopify store built by a freelancer typically costs $3,000-$15,000 CAD depending on complexity. Basic stores with theme customization start around $3,000-$5,000 CAD, while fully custom builds with unique features, app integrations, and multi-currency support range from $8,000-$15,000+ CAD.

Should I hire a freelancer or an agency for my e-commerce project?

Freelancers are ideal for defined projects with clear scope — like a store build, a marketing campaign, or a platform migration. They typically offer lower rates, more direct communication, and faster turnaround. Agencies are better suited for ongoing, multi-disciplinary needs where you need a coordinated team across design, development, and marketing simultaneously.

What e-commerce platform do Canadian freelancers work with most?

Shopify dominates the Canadian e-commerce freelancer market, which is fitting since Shopify is headquartered in Ottawa. You'll find the largest pool of skilled developers and designers on the Shopify platform. WooCommerce is the second most popular, particularly for businesses already using WordPress. BigCommerce and Magento freelancers are available but less common.

How do I find freelancers who understand Canadian e-commerce regulations?

Look for freelancers who have built stores for other Canadian businesses and can demonstrate knowledge of CASL compliance for email marketing, bilingual requirements, Canadian tax calculation, and consumer protection laws. Ask specifically about their experience with Canada-specific payment gateways and shipping integrations.
